Leading Digital Commerce Platforms of 2024 : Characteristics & Costs
Finding the right digital commerce platform can be a crucial decision for any company . In 2024 , several top contenders offer diverse functionalities to suit various needs and budgets. Shopify remains a popular choice, known for its ease of use and extensive app store, with pricing starting at around $29 per month – though transaction fees can add up. WooCommerce, a WordPress plugin, provides great flexibility but requires more technical expertise; it’s technically free, but hosting and extensions will incur expenses . BigCommerce offers robust scalability for larger businesses , with rates generally starting above $29 per month. copyright is a good option for smaller stores, particularly those already familiar with the Wix website builder, and offers affordable plans . Finally, Squarespace Commerce provides a visually appealing solution, ideal for businesses focused on aesthetics, although its customization choices might be slightly limited; they offer various levels, beginning around $ 18 per month. Finally , the best platform depends entirely on your specific needs and resources.

Ecommerce Platforms Showdown: Shopify
Choosing the optimal online store solution can feel overwhelming , especially with so many choices available. Let's take a look at three of the top players: Shopify, WooCommerce, and BigCommerce. Shopify offers a user-friendly integrated solution with hosted infrastructure, appealing to beginners and those who prefer less technical involvement, but can be pricier in the long run due to transaction fees and app subscriptions. WooCommerce, on the other hand, is a open-source plugin for WordPress, providing incredible flexibility and customization – perfect for users comfortable with managing their own hosting and website; however, this requires more technical expertise. BigCommerce provides a robust feature set geared towards larger businesses with advanced marketing tools and impressive scalability, though its pricing structure can be more complicated than Shopify’s.
